mysql - 有关设置 MariaDB 10.1.x 主-主集群的信息

标签 mysql mariadb

我正在尝试设置一个新的 MariaDB 10.1.x 集群,以便从 mysql 迁移新应用程序。我似乎找不到任何基于新的 MariaDB 10.1.x 的信息,有人可以帮助我解决这个问题吗?有人做过吗?

非常感谢!!!

最佳答案

首先您需要启用 MariaDB 10.1.x 存储库。根据您的 Linux 发行版和版本,其内容可能有所不同。这是 MariaDB repository generator .

在 CentOS 6 x64 上,/etc/yum.repos.d/MariaDB.repo 具有以下内容:

[mariadb]
name = MariaDB
baseurl = http://yum.mariadb.org/10.1/centos6-amd64
gpgkey=https://yum.mariadb.org/RPM-GPG-KEY-MariaDB
gpgcheck=1

下一步是安装本身。查看此链接了解详细信息:http://galeracluster.com/documentation-webpages/installmariadb.html

或者..如果您使用的是 RHEL/CentOS/Fedora,只需运行:

yum install MariaDB-Galera-server MariaDB-client galera

如果该机器上已经安装了 MySQL,它将被替换为最新的 MariaDB 10.1.x。您不会丢失数据库,所以不用担心。 对所有节点重复该过程。

最后也是最长的一步是阅读 Galera Cluster Documentation 。花点时间深入研究一下。您越了解数据库集群的含义,以后遇到的麻烦就越少。 快乐的聚类! :-)

关于mysql - 有关设置 MariaDB 10.1.x 主-主集群的信息,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/33395197/

相关文章:

mysql - 如何获取每个类别具有不同限制的类别随机记录

postgresql - 数据库是否推荐使用容器?

mysql - 如何恢复通过在 phpmyadmin 中重命名为相同名称不同大小写而删除的 MariaDB 数据库

mysql - MariaDB 嵌套选择

php - 数据库条目未正确输出

php - 如何在 codeigniter 中使用 img_library 调整多个图像的大小

mysql - 紧凑型(): Undefined variable: users

php - 有没有一种方法可以记录用户在 MySQL 数据库中提交表单的浏览器

mysql - 无法使用 DBeaver 连接到本地主机上的 MariaDB

javascript - 无法弄清楚为什么我在创建数据库表时出错